Factors Affecting Cost

  • Extent of Damage: The severity of the smoke damage will significantly influence the overall cost.
    • Size of Affected Area: Larger areas require more resources and time to clean, increasing the overall expense.
  • Type of Smoke Residue: Different types of smoke (wet, dry, oily) require specific cleaning methods and materials.
  • Structural Damage: If the smoke has caused structural damage, repairs will add to the total cost.
  • Cleaning Supplies and Equipment: The cost of specialized cleaning agents and equipment can vary.
  • Labor Costs: The number of professionals needed and their expertise level will impact the price.
  • Time Required: Longer cleanup processes will naturally result in higher costs.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ost Range
Initial Assessment and Inspection $200 - $500
Soot and Smoke Removal $2,000 - $6,000
Odor Removal $200 - $1,000
Air Duct Cleaning $300 - $700
Carpet and Upholstery Cleaning $150 - $500 per room
Wall and Ceiling Cleaning $1,000 - $3,000
Furniture Cleaning $100 - $500 per piece
Full Restoration Services $5,000 - $20,000
